Odia music composer Abhijit Majumdar
Renowned Odia music composer Abhijit Majumdar remains in a coma and is in critical condition. Authorities are considering shifting him to AIIMS Delhi for advanced treatment if required.
On Sunday, Odisha Health Minister Mukesh Mahaling visited AIIMS Bhubaneswar and reviewed Majumdar’s health condition with doctors and family members. He assured that the Odisha government will bear all medical expenses and has directed that a special medical team be engaged in his treatment. For specialized care, consultations with AIIMS Delhi will also be arranged.
As per reports, Majumdar had been suffering from multiple health issues, including hypertension, hypothyroidism, and chronic liver disease, before slipping into a coma. He has been placed on a ventilator, and while his organs are functioning normally so far. However, doctors have detected a vitamin deficiency. He remains in the ICU under ventilator support.
Majumdar is currently undergoing treatment, and though his condition has not shown signs of improvement, it has not deteriorated either. If the situation demands, he will be shifted to AIIMS Delhi for advanced medical intervention.
Health Minister Mukesh Mahaling said, “After discussing with doctors, we found out that all the treatment is being done following the right protocol. His organs are functioning fine so far. A team of doctors is already treating him, and we will also consult with a team of doctors from Delhi AIIMS. I have instructed that a special team of doctors start treating him, and we hope that he recovers soon.”
